3330 70th St #120, Lubbock, TX 79413
1966 miles away from Wytopitlock, Maine
4413 71st St Suite G-101, Lubbock, TX 79424
1967.2 miles away from Wytopitlock, Maine
391 Rd 1Af, Powell, WY 82435
1969.7 miles away from Wytopitlock, Maine